Company overview
Havells India Limited is one of India's largest fast-moving electrical goods (FMEG) and consumer durables companies. Founded in 1958 in Delhi as Havells Industries, the company operates manufacturing facilities at Alwar, Faridabad, Baddi, Sahibabad, Haridwar, and Neemrana. FY25 revenue approximately ₹22,500 crore. Brands include Havells (consumer electrical and lighting), Lloyd (air conditioners, refrigerators, washing machines, TVs), Crabtree (premium switches and sockets), Standard (mass-market switches), and REO (entry-segment).
Business model
Five segments: Switchgear (MCBs, RCCBs, distribution boards), Cables and Wires, Lighting (LED and conventional), Electrical Consumer Durables (fans, geysers, air coolers), and Lloyd Consumer (white goods).
Operating segments
Switchgear
MCBs, RCCBs, distribution boards. Premium positioning.
Cables and Wires
House wires, industrial cables, optical fibre cables.
Lighting
LED lamps, tubelights, streetlights, decorative.
Electrical Consumer Durables
Fans, water heaters, air coolers, kitchen appliances.
Lloyd Consumer
Acquired Lloyd brand in 2017. ACs, refrigerators, washing machines, TVs.
Recent developments
21 May 2026Havells India reported its Q4 and full-year FY2026 results for the period ended March 31, 2026, delivering a profit beat despite persistent headwinds from its Lloyd business segment [6,8]. However, analyst coverage suggests there are underlying issues warranting attention within the company's earnings trajectory [5]. Historical operating profit data spanning 2020–2024 provides context for evaluating the company's longer-term performance trends [9].
Strategically, Havells has been expanding its operational footprint, notably enhancing facilities in the Northeast region where it now employs over 750 people [3]. On the corporate governance front, the company appointed Varun Berry as an Independent Director [10]. For investor updates, a dividend date has been announced [2], while Kundan Edifice recently secured ₹2.44 Crore in orders from Havells, reflecting continued business-to-business engagement [1].

Financial performance and recent trajectory
FY25 revenue ₹22,500 crore. EBITDA margin 11-13 percent. Lloyd profitability has been variable.
Stock performance and shareholder context
Havells (NSE: HAVELLS, BSE: 517354) is Nifty 50 constituent. Promoter holding approximately 59 percent.

Competitive position
Among top-3 in switchgear (with Schneider Electric and ABB India), cables (with Polycab and KEI Industries), lighting (with Crompton, Philips Signify), fans (with Crompton, Bajaj Electricals). Lloyd competes with Voltas, Daikin, LG, Samsung in ACs.
Key risks
Real estate cycle for switchgear; raw material inflation (copper, aluminium); summer AC season demand; Voltas-Beko aggressive pricing.
Outlook
Capacity expansion across all segments. Lloyd brand turnaround focus.
